14131531 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 14131532. Its totient is φ = 14131530.

The previous prime is 14131501. The next prime is 14131541. The reversal of 14131531 is 13513141.

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-14131531 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×141315312 = 399400336807922, which contains 22 as substring.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 14131499 and 14131508.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(14131501) by changing a digit.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 7065765 + 7065766.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(7065766).

Almost surely, 214131531 is an apocalyptic number.

14131531 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

14131531 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

14131531 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its digits is 180, while the sum is 19.

The square root of 14131531 is about 3759.1928654965. The cubic root of 14131531 is about 241.7666568923.

Adding to 14131531 its reverse (13513141), we get a palindrome (27644672).

The spelling of 14131531 in words is "fourteen million, one hundred thirty-one thousand, five hundred thirty-one".
